jfm 06-19-2009 10:00 PM


Originally Posted by jetheadracer (Post 2892586)
Do you know what the part #'s are for the 25 outlaw, I actually need that stuff and had no clue of how to get the numbers.

Bomar's #'s are let me know if I can help

1767796 - HATCH, DECK QUADRILATERAL WHT PRT - 1
1767797 - HATCH, DECK QUADRILATERAL WHT STB - 1

1003011 - TRIM RING, HATCH PARALLELOGRAM PORT - 1
1003029 - TRIM RING, HATCH PARALLELOGRAM STBD - 1

1458934 - GASKET, BAJA-01 DECK HATCH - 1 PR
1006048 - SCREEN, DECK HATCH QUAD - 2 (OPTIONAL)

XT-Innovator 11-10-2009 12:38 PM


Originally Posted by irishtornado (Post 2988213)
Same design, but different hatch. I'm guessing that hatch was used on the 335

Come-on, your both wrong on this one! That is the Baja 342 hatch, but it was also used on the 442, and late model 320's.

The 302 hatch is the same as the rear set of 38 Special hatches, and the 335 is the same as the 275, and 405. The 278 was a new design, but not many were produced.

XT-Innovator 03-03-2010 12:29 PM


Originally Posted by jvcobra (Post 3058962)
I could use the trim too, and maybe a whole hatch. It just won't look right next to my brand new XT interior. Come on Dave use your powers to get us some part numbers :)

Joe,

The Hatches were made by Spartech Marine who is no longer fabricating anything, and the early molded trim was made by the same company that makes the glove box liners. If the molded trim rings accept the screen options, they were made by Bomar Marine, but I don't have access to the part numbers any longer.
